WebElectric energy consumption is energy consumption in the form of electrical energy. About a fifth of global energy is consumed as electricity: for residential, industrial, commercial, transportation and other purposes. Wind and solar generated over a tenth (10.3%) of global electricity for the first time in 2024, rising from 9.3% in 2024, and twice the share compared to 2015 when the Paris Climate Agreement was signed (4.6%). Combined, clean electricity sources generated 38% of the world’s electricity in 2024, more than coal (36%).
